of Lissenden Works, Gordon House Road, London NW5

of Wilson Rd, Huyton, Liverpool (works)

1947 Rothermel Corporation had equipped a factory to make vacuuum flasks which would be operated as British Vacuum Flask Co Ltd, a subsidiary established by Hassid, Austin and Co[1]

1953 Moved to Huyton; Rothermel Corporation bought out the 20 percent minority interest[2]

1954 Subsidiary of Rothermel Corporation[3]

1957 Became part of Simms Motor and Electronics Corporation
